Mophie Power Boost vs OtterBox Portable Power Bank: Two Compact Chargers, Very Different Priorities

Portable power banks have become everyday essentials, and both the Mophie Power Boost and the OtterBox Portable Power Bank aim to solve the same core problem: keeping smartphones and small devices charged on the go. At a glance, they share familiar traits such as lithium-polymer batteries, USB-C input, support for USB Power Delivery, and pocket-friendly designs. Dig deeper, however, and clear differences emerge around battery capacity, power output, and durability focus. These distinctions shape who each power bank is best suited for, whether that is extended travel or rugged daily carry.

The Mophie Power Boost positions itself as a higher-capacity, performance-oriented charger released in 2023, designed to handle smartphones and tablets with ease. In contrast, the OtterBox Portable Power Bank, introduced in 2020, emphasizes compactness, rugged construction, and wireless-friendly usability. Both sit at nearly the same price point, which makes the comparison less about cost and more about priorities.

Why the Mophie Power Boost Leans Toward Power Users

The most obvious advantage of the Mophie Power Boost is its 10000 mAh battery capacity. This is double the capacity of the OtterBox model, and it translates directly into fewer recharge cycles and more total device charges over a day or weekend. For users carrying multiple devices or relying on navigation, streaming, or hotspot use, this extra headroom can make a practical difference.

Output performance is another area where Mophie pulls ahead. With a maximum output of 18 Watt, it supports both Power Delivery and Quick Charge standards. This allows compatible phones and tablets to charge noticeably faster than standard 5 Watt outputs. The inclusion of two output ports, USB-A and USB-C, also enables simultaneous device charging without sacrificing stability.

Efficiency and control features further reinforce its performance-focused design. The Mophie Power Boost lists an energy conversion efficiency of 85 percent and includes power distribution control to manage load intelligently. It also supports a low-power device mode, which is useful for wearables and accessories that draw minimal current. These details suggest careful tuning for a wider range of charging scenarios.

From a safety and compliance standpoint, the Mophie unit carries UL, CE, FCC, and RoHS certifications, signaling adherence to recognized electrical and material standards. Combined with thermal protection, overcurrent safeguards, and a defined thermal cutoff threshold of 140 °F, the Power Boost is clearly engineered with sustained performance in mind. Its trade-off is durability, offering moderate impact resistance and a 3 ft drop rating, rather than heavy-duty protection.

Where the OtterBox Portable Power Bank Stands Its Ground

OtterBox has built its reputation on rugged accessories, and that DNA shows clearly in its Portable Power Bank. While its 5000 mAh capacity is modest, the design emphasizes durability over raw power. It features high impact resistance, structural reinforcement, scratch resistance, and reinforced ports, all of which are valuable for users who are hard on their gear.

Convenience features help offset its lower output. The OtterBox model includes auto wake and auto sleep functionality, meaning it begins charging when a device is connected without requiring button presses. This may sound minor, but it improves usability in quick, everyday situations where simplicity matters more than speed.

Portability is another strength. Weighing just 0.28 lbs and measuring 0.57 inches in height, it slips easily into a pocket or bag. Although it only supports a 7.5 Watt maximum output, that level is often sufficient for topping up a smartphone during commutes or short outings.

Longevity and support also favor OtterBox. The power bank comes with a 24-month warranty, compared to Mophie’s 12 months, and includes a short charging cable in the box. It also highlights the use of sustainable materials and holds an Energy Star certification, which may appeal to environmentally conscious buyers who value efficiency over raw capacity.

Quick Take

The Mophie Power Boost stands out for its higher capacity, faster charging speeds, and broader device compatibility, making it suitable for heavier usage patterns. The OtterBox Portable Power Bank, on the other hand, prioritizes durability, simplicity, and portability, even if that means slower charging and fewer total charges. Choosing between them depends less on price and more on how demanding your charging needs are.

Bottom Line Recommendation

If performance and versatility matter most, the Mophie Power Boost is the stronger overall option, especially for users who charge multiple devices or tablets. Its larger battery, higher wattage output, and advanced power management justify its design choices. Those who value toughness and grab-and-go convenience may still find the OtterBox appealing, but it is more specialized in scope.
